Eligibility

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1.Smoking index (SI) > 300 [No. of cigarettes smoked per day x No. Of years of smoking] 2.Pack years index (PYI) >40 [ No. of years of smoking x No of packets of cigarettes per day] 3.Shiyanoyaâ??s criteria for T.A.O Tobacco use, only in males Disease starts before 45 years. Distal extremities involved first without embolic or atherosclerotic features. Absence of diabetes mellitus or hyperlipidaemia. With or without thrombophlebitis. Patient who are ready to participate and sig n the informed consent form.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Cases of diabetes mellitus with peripheral neuropathies, cardiac diseases, bleeding disorders, thrombocytopenia, any other severe systemic diseases. 2. Chronic ulcers due to varicose veins
